CNC Swiss lathes generally make parts less than 2 inches in outer diameter. They run by going a set tooling jig to your bar inventory. These tools Minimize very near to the spindle makes tool modifications incredibly swift. The key difference between CNC Swiss together with other CNC lathes is how the bar feeder and spindle work collectively to generate parts. The spindle on a Swiss CNC lathe controls the bar movement towards a stationary Device to the tooling jig.
